Digimarc Barcode

A Digimarc barcode is a hidden digital watermark. It is a new type of barcode that is hidden within the packaging design, repeating across the surface and is almost invisible.

It goes into packaging, labels, or printed materials. You can scan it with devices like smartphones or retail scanners. Digimarc barcodes are different from traditional barcodes or QR codes. They blend into the design, so they don’t take up space. This makes scanning faster and more efficient.

How Digimarc Barcodes Work

  1. Invisible Integration: The barcode is built into the whole package or label. This lets it be scanned from different angles.
  2. High-Speed Scanning: The code is all over the design, so scanners can read it quicker than regular barcodes.
  3. Connected Data: Scanning the code shows product details, tracks stock, aids recycling, or links customers to digital content.

Uses of Digimarc Barcodes

  • Retail & Packaging: Speeds up checkout and improves inventory tracking.
  • Brand Protection: Helps to detect counterfeit products.
  • Recycling & Sustainability: Provides sorting information for waste management.
  • Marketing & Engagement: Links consumers to digital content like promotions, product details, or videos.

Digimarc barcodes are invisible and cover the whole surface. This makes it easier and more efficient to link physical products with digital experiences.
